软件外包的安全管理是一个复杂且多层次的过程,涉及多个方面的措施和策略。以下是一些关键的安全管理措施:
制定安全管理制度和规范
制定详细的安全管理制度和操作规程,明确各岗位的安全职责和操作要求。
确保制度符合国家和地方的法律法规及标准要求,并根据实际情况及时更新和完善。
安全评估和审计
对外包服务提供商进行定期的安全评估和审计,评估其安全防护能力和漏洞修复情况。
对外包服务的安全事件进行调查和取证。
数据安全和隐私保护
建立严格的数据安全管理制度,包括访问控制、数据备份和恢复、数据加密、安全审计等措施。
采用数据加密技术、网络安全技术、访问控制技术等手段来保护客户数据的安全和隐私性。
定期对外包工作场所进行安全检查,及时发现和消除安全隐患。
人员配备和管理
配备专业的安全团队,负责外包服务的安全监控和防护。
对外包团队成员进行安全培训和教育,提高其安全意识和操作技能。
定期进行安全知识宣传和案例警示教育,加强员工的安全意识。
应急响应机制
建立及时有效的安全事件响应机制,制定外包工作的应急预案,明确应急组织、救援程序和资源调配方案。
定期进行安全演练和应急演练,快速处置和恢复安全事件。
合同和协议
与外包服务提供商签订明确的安全协议,确保双方对安全责任和义务有清晰的认识。
在合同中明确安全要求和标准,确保外包公司按照合同履行。
技术和管理手段
采用先进的技术手段来保护数据安全和隐私保护,如数据加密、网络安全、访问控制等。
使用DevOps等技术手段确保软件开发质量,确保系统后期能够交给任意公司继续开发。
基础设施管理
提供安全可靠的基础设施,如高品质的硬件设备和网络设备,确保服务的稳定性和可靠性。
对基础设施进行管理和监控,及时发现和解决潜在的问题。
通过以上措施,可以有效地管理软件外包过程中的安全风险,确保项目的顺利进行和客户数据的安全。建议在选择外包服务提供商时,要对其进行严格的安全评估和背景调查,并在合同中明确安全要求和责任,以便在出现安全问题时能够及时应对和解决。